Class SModifiersImpl
- java.lang.Object
 - 
- jetbrains.mps.core.aspects.behaviour.SModifiersImpl
 
 
- 
- All Implemented Interfaces:
 SModifiers
public final class SModifiersImpl extends Object implements SModifiers
 
- 
- 
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static SModifiersImplcreate(boolean aStatic, boolean aFinal, boolean aVirtual, boolean aAbstract, AccessPrivileges accessPrivileges)static SModifiersImplcreate(int mask, AccessPrivileges accessPrivileges)booleanequals(Object o)inthashCode()booleanisAbstract()booleanisFinal()booleanisPackage()booleanisPrivate()booleanisProtected()booleanisPublic()booleanisStatic()booleanisVirtual()StringtoString() 
 - 
 
- 
- 
Field Detail
- 
STATIC
public static final int STATIC
- See Also:
 - Constant Field Values
 
 
- 
FINAL
public static final int FINAL
- See Also:
 - Constant Field Values
 
 
- 
ABSTRACT
public static final int ABSTRACT
- See Also:
 - Constant Field Values
 
 
- 
VIRTUAL
public static final int VIRTUAL
- See Also:
 - Constant Field Values
 
 
 - 
 
- 
Method Detail
- 
isPublic
public boolean isPublic()
- Specified by:
 isPublicin interfaceSModifiers
 
- 
isPrivate
public boolean isPrivate()
- Specified by:
 isPrivatein interfaceSModifiers
 
- 
isProtected
public boolean isProtected()
- Specified by:
 isProtectedin interfaceSModifiers
 
- 
isPackage
public boolean isPackage()
- Specified by:
 isPackagein interfaceSModifiers
 
- 
isStatic
public boolean isStatic()
- Specified by:
 isStaticin interfaceSModifiers
 
- 
isFinal
public boolean isFinal()
- Specified by:
 isFinalin interfaceSModifiers
 
- 
isVirtual
public boolean isVirtual()
- Specified by:
 isVirtualin interfaceSModifiers
 
- 
isAbstract
public boolean isAbstract()
- Specified by:
 isAbstractin interfaceSModifiers
 
- 
create
@NotNull public static SModifiersImpl create(boolean aStatic, boolean aFinal, boolean aVirtual, boolean aAbstract, @NotNull AccessPrivileges accessPrivileges)
 
- 
create
@NotNull public static SModifiersImpl create(int mask, @NotNull AccessPrivileges accessPrivileges)
 
 - 
 
 -